Technical Description

The Komatsu PC150-5 is a robust hydraulic excavator engineered for demanding construction and excavation tasks. Available in three boom/stick configurations, it offers a maximum cutting height of up to 29.4 ft, a maximum digging depth of 20.9 ft, and a maximum reach along the ground of 29.8 ft, providing exceptional versatility for a wide range of digging and loading applications. The excavator’s maximum loading height reaches 20.9 ft, and its vertical wall digging depth extends to 17.7 ft, ensuring efficient performance in trenching and foundation work. The shipping dimensions are compact, with a maximum shipping length of 28 ft and a height of 9.6 ft, facilitating easy transport. The machine is equipped with a powerful S6D95L engine, delivering 99.3 hp at 2000 rpm, and features a displacement of 298.5 cu in. The hydraulic system is designed for high efficiency, with a pump flow capacity of 73 gpm and a relief valve pressure of 4620 psi. The operating weight is 33,907.1 lbs, and the fuel capacity is 60.8 gallons, supporting extended operation. The undercarriage is built for stability, with a ground pressure of 7 psi, a maximum travel speed of 3.5 mph, and a track gauge of 6.6 ft. The excavator’s dimensions include a ground clearance of 1.5 ft, a height to the top of the cab of 9.3 ft, and a width to the outside of the tracks of 8.2 ft. The swing mechanism operates at 12 rpm, ensuring smooth and precise rotation. The bucket capacity ranges from 0.8 to 1 cu yd, with a reference capacity of 0.9 cu yd, making it suitable for various material handling needs.
